Dragon School has an exciting opportunity for a Head of Woodwind and Brassto join the team.

The Head of Woodwind and Brass is responsible for the development of wind and brass playing at the School, agreeing a broad overview and vision in close consultation with the Director of Music.

They must show awareness for the other Heads of Section and display the skills required to assist and liaise effectively with these members of staff, in order to facilitate the smooth running of the department.

The role involves a combination of teaching, directing ensembles and leading a team of teachers, with general responsibility for the provision of opportunities and resources for wind and brass playing within the department.

The successful candidate would have a specialism in woodwind and should also have accompanying skills.
